MARK'S NOTCAST Ep 84 : New Order's "Republic" 1992-1993. 19 April 2021.

Notcast Episode 84 : In 1993, New Order released their sixth album, the troubled "Republic", around the time their record label collapsed, their nightclub The Hacienda swallowed all the money, London Records invested a couple of million of pounds in them, played just 13 shows, released 12 songs, did 4 singles - "Regret", "Ruined In A Day", "World" and "Spooky", did videos with budgets of £300,000 (!), one longform documentary movie, and then split up again. It was a strange time to be a fan of a band. Also, a brief excursion into 'Disc Rot' and how much I hate the cheapskates at the PDO Factory in Preston for ruining my CD's. 19 April 2021.
